Yaroslav Greshilov shares the experience of the FAILED launch of the ILoveCinema social network.
“Thesis one: if you need mass attendance, create services, and not community. Building a community is a long and hard work that does not bring large dividends.
We started with community and communication services, with the result that won as accomplices, but greatly lost in quantity. ')
In our case it should have been a personal film collection, automatic recommendations and personal poster.
The thesis of the second: start small. Design the basic service that will be the most popular among your audience, and start first it, and then develop the project and add new functionality to it. we at the time of starting the project they did not understand this, Getting Real did not read and designed such a colossus in which all possible useful social (and not only) services for moviegoers.
We spent a huge amount of time solving tasks that are not are critical for recruiting an audience. ”
